summarylogtreecommitdiffstats
diff options
context:
space:
mode:
authorOleksandr Natalenko2021-12-20 08:51:42 +0100
committerOleksandr Natalenko2021-12-20 08:51:42 +0100
commit54ea21358d8eca595b3c7ac7560ea3de3d261fd7 (patch)
treef52bb8011bf87f2b4473928b854e9ab8921f3bc2
parent4b5275cfef0ac23502725e8cdc7d86e0b6e2480b (diff)
downloadaur-54ea21358d8eca595b3c7ac7560ea3de3d261fd7.tar.gz
bump to accomodate updated deps
Signed-off-by: Oleksandr Natalenko <oleksandr@natalenko.name>
-rw-r--r--.SRCINFO10
-rw-r--r--PKGBUILD17
-rw-r--r--encrypted-dns.service1
3 files changed, 15 insertions, 13 deletions
diff --git a/.SRCINFO b/.SRCINFO
index 61a39deb3ee6..ed8d158a4cc1 100644
--- a/.SRCINFO
+++ b/.SRCINFO
@@ -1,16 +1,16 @@
pkgbase = encrypted-dns
pkgdesc = A modern encrypted DNS server (DNSCrypt v2, Anonymized DNSCrypt, DoH)
- pkgver = 0.9.1
+ pkgver = 0.9.1.r1.7b39ea4554
pkgrel = 2
- url = https://github.com/jedisct1/encrypted-dns-server
+ url = https://github.com/DNSCrypt/encrypted-dns-server
arch = x86_64
license = MIT
makedepends = rust
makedepends = cargo
backup = etc/encrypted-dns/encrypted-dns.toml
- source = encrypted-dns-0.9.1.tar.gz::https://github.com/jedisct1/encrypted-dns-server/archive/0.9.1.tar.gz
+ source = encrypted-dns-0.9.1.r1.7b39ea4554.tar.gz::https://github.com/DNSCrypt/encrypted-dns-server/archive/7b39ea4554b18bce4381ff3a17769bc7baca55d6.tar.gz
source = encrypted-dns.service
- sha256sums = 8b25b568e8b583bd04cdd0b5f4e2a684675877d1155cc44423baec4696c09511
- sha256sums = 1f1c0221fd05019f9d3d8aa2bbf22b845daef8a408f86442c7fa5b5afe720d04
+ sha256sums = 472053d16f07d23ca436b847b6875b8c0137fa55ac2d1352471796660ab32574
+ sha256sums = 6de2ead853fc3de465ebcb3bd9e26edbb361c9dcc1afa3703eb0c8ce05d28676
pkgname = encrypted-dns
diff --git a/PKGBUILD b/PKGBUILD
index da9fe82e6184..b5071b8bc540 100644
--- a/PKGBUILD
+++ b/PKGBUILD
@@ -1,21 +1,22 @@
# Maintainer: Oleksandr Natalenko <oleksandr@natalenko.name>
pkgname=encrypted-dns
-pkgver=0.9.1
+_rev=7b39ea4554b18bce4381ff3a17769bc7baca55d6
+pkgver=0.9.1.r1.${_rev:0:10}
pkgrel=2
pkgdesc="A modern encrypted DNS server (DNSCrypt v2, Anonymized DNSCrypt, DoH)"
-url="https://github.com/jedisct1/encrypted-dns-server"
+url="https://github.com/DNSCrypt/encrypted-dns-server"
license=(MIT)
arch=(x86_64)
-source=(${pkgname}-${pkgver}.tar.gz::https://github.com/jedisct1/encrypted-dns-server/archive/${pkgver}.tar.gz
+source=(${pkgname}-${pkgver}.tar.gz::https://github.com/DNSCrypt/encrypted-dns-server/archive/${_rev}.tar.gz
encrypted-dns.service)
backup=(etc/encrypted-dns/encrypted-dns.toml)
makedepends=(rust cargo)
-sha256sums=('8b25b568e8b583bd04cdd0b5f4e2a684675877d1155cc44423baec4696c09511'
- '1f1c0221fd05019f9d3d8aa2bbf22b845daef8a408f86442c7fa5b5afe720d04')
+sha256sums=('472053d16f07d23ca436b847b6875b8c0137fa55ac2d1352471796660ab32574'
+ '6de2ead853fc3de465ebcb3bd9e26edbb361c9dcc1afa3703eb0c8ce05d28676')
prepare() {
- cd ${pkgname}-server-${pkgver}
+ cd ${pkgname}-server-${_rev}
sed -i 's|state_file = "encrypted-dns.state"|state_file = "/var/lib/encrypted-dns/encrypted-dns.state"|' example-encrypted-dns.toml
sed -i 's|# log_file = "/tmp/encrypted-dns.log"|log_file = "/var/log/encrypted-dns/encrypted-dns.log"|' example-encrypted-dns.toml
@@ -26,13 +27,13 @@ prepare() {
}
build() {
- cd ${pkgname}-server-${pkgver}
+ cd ${pkgname}-server-${_rev}
cargo build --release
}
package() {
- cd ${pkgname}-server-${pkgver}
+ cd ${pkgname}-server-${_rev}
install -Dt "${pkgdir}"/usr/bin -m0755 target/release/encrypted-dns
install -Dm0644 example-encrypted-dns.toml "${pkgdir}"/etc/encrypted-dns/encrypted-dns.toml
diff --git a/encrypted-dns.service b/encrypted-dns.service
index 8bfd7922c416..baf05e342053 100644
--- a/encrypted-dns.service
+++ b/encrypted-dns.service
@@ -37,6 +37,7 @@ RuntimeDirectory=encrypted-dns
StateDirectory=encrypted-dns
LogsDirectory=encrypted-dns
ExecStart=/usr/bin/encrypted-dns -c /etc/encrypted-dns/encrypted-dns.toml
+Restart=on-failure
[Install]
WantedBy=multi-user.target